#603578 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#603578 is composed of 37.6% red, 20.8% green and 47.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 20% cyan, 55.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 52.9% black. It has a hue angle of 278.5 degrees, a saturation of 38.7% and a lightness of 33.9%. #603578 color hex could be obtained by blending #c06af0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

#603578 color description : Dark moderate violet.

#603578 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#603578 has RGB values of R:96, G:53, B:120 and CMYK values of C:0.2, M:0.56, Y:0, K:0.53. Its decimal value is 6305144.

Shades and Tints of #603578

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#09050b is the darkest color, while #fdfdf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#603578

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#575657 is the less saturated color, while #6d06a7 is the most saturated one.
